Chapter one: Abducted

Grace looked out through the window as the carriage pulled to a stop. They were here, her heart beat increased more than it should, a letter was all she was to deliver. She waited for the driver to open the door and gently got off the carriage.

She didn't know why her father had to rent out one of the finest carriages in town and get her a new gown just for an errand but she didn't dare question it. Before her stood a huge building that resembled the house of elders in her village, only that this one was slightly bigger and isolated.

"I'd be right back." She said to the coach man as a form of reassurance to herself. She had no idea why, but she felt some kind of off energy engulfing her. She gathered her skirts and swiftly walked over unto the steps. The moment her feet floated over the last step, the wide doors opened up and like a compelling spell, she entered.

A man appeared out of no where scaring her almost to death, he was all dressed in black, the only other color was on his hair.

"This way my lady"

Mouth wide opened, she nodded, pulling herself together. She was more than eager to get out of this place.

"I'm, I'm, I'm um... I'm looking for... "

She brought out the sealed letter from her purse to check the name it was addressed to. "Um... Mr Dante"

The man chuckled lightly, "This way" He repeated again, walking ahead of her through the corridor.

The atmosphere made Grace's heart heavy but it was a lot to tell to Cecelia when she got home. Suddenly she paused, looking around. The man had mysteriously disappeared. Her heart beat picked up, throwing her in confusion and fear.

But before her was a door. Different thoughts made it's way into her head, was she supposed to open the door? Or what if she disappeared too like that man? Was she going to die? Suddenly, the thought of death made want to faint. No! She heaved a breath and squared her shoulders, lifing both her hands out to push open the doors. A force shoved her in and shut the door instinctively, she clamped her hands over her mouth to keep the voice out.

"You're here"

A voice echoed throughout the room and a man who she hadn't noticed standing by the closed curtains came towards her. He looked more of a duke rather than an elder, Grace thought opening her mouth to talk.

"Yes, and my father um.....-"

She stopped talking when he came to a stop infront of her barely a distance between both of them, indignant, Grace stepped back, unfortunately meeting the door.

"You look better than your father described to me."

"Yes .. um... Thank you. But my father asked to give you this letter" she stretched it forward.

Whilst he opened the letter, Grace ran her eyes over him. He was more of Cecilia's type, tall, huge, dressed in no more than black, his hair packed at the back of his head, his eyes a disturbing green.

"Give me your hand"

Grace's lips trembled

"No. I have to go. I was sent only to deliver your letter and I have. So .. I have to leave"

She said starting to turn away.

"Go on"

"Thank you"

She released a breath turning to pull the door open. Once the view of the hallway was in sight, she hurried through it, never wishing to be in such circumstance again. She wondered where her father knew a such man like this. She headed towards the big doors with determination, hoping the door would open the same way it has when she wanted to enter the first place.

And it did. She ran out, stopping in her tracks when the coach man and the carriage was no where to be seen.

"Micheal." She called out, as that was the Coachman's name, her heart palpitating at the thought of him leaving her. She started to descend the stairs only to find her legs stuck on the wooden build.

"Micheal" she cried out once more, wrapping her hands about a leg to free her feet from something she could not see.

"Let me help you"

The sound of a man behind her made her jump in fear except that she didn't move. It was the man from before, the one who had led her into that room and disappeared.

"Don't worry, I don't need your help. I'm fine."

Her voice was laced with great fear, one she had never encountered in her entire life.

He hoisted her up anyway, bringing her inside, into the room she once cringed at and disappeared again.

"Why do you run?"

Dante asked in the most honest concerned tone ever coming so close as he had done before. The sound of her heart beat trashing against it's walls made him curious as it was unpleasing to his ears.

She shook her head at his question, too fearful to speak afraid that he might do something to her.

He almost simpered but curiously asked instead.

"Your father didn't tell you?"

"Tell me what?" Her voice broke down

"You're in safe hands my dear" He said turning away. "Get some rest, we leave for Argos in the morning. "

"Argos isn't my home."

He waved his hands in the air as if scrolling through a discarded paper, bringing them in a room in a swift second. Grace was sure her heart stopped beating. Elders in her town had powers but not like this.

"You may rest here for the mean time."

The moment he made to bring out his hands from his pockets, Grace flew to him attempting to escape to wherever he'd go. But it was a dumb idea. He moved away in a matter of seconds causing her to fall on the floor.

"Please let me go. You absolutely have no use for me."

"I infact do. My beloved wife"
